Google DeepMind introduced Gemini Robotics-ER 1.6

Google DeepMind has introduced Gemini Robotics-ER 1.6, an embodied reasoning model designed for real-world robotics tasks. The release represents an iteration in DeepMind's efforts to adapt its multimodal Gemini architecture for physical interaction and environment manipulation. Why it matters

Spatial reasoning and 3D environment comprehension remain critical bottlenecks in transitioning multimodal AI from digital interfaces to physical robotics. Advancements in embodied reasoning foundation models could accelerate automation across manufacturing, logistics, and field robotics, lowering development friction for autonomous systems requiring complex real-world interaction.
